Output 52670ed8c79d11f80fc55e38cd85bd217b402c3d6f18267a8c64de3599e229ea:2

value
116705
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2e9bc33662761a26f08df434a73a517706a5f52 OP_EQUAL
address
3J12Ctko6SRcFx8tnhBrGCYChzcRcEUVH4
transaction
52670ed8c79d11f80fc55e38cd85bd217b402c3d6f18267a8c64de3599e229ea
spent
true